Configuration Parameters
ixany_flow_control
This asynchronous port parameter treats any input character as a start (XON) character, if output
has been suspended by a stop (XOFF) character. A Y enables this parameter, an N disables it. The
default is N.

keep_alive_timer

This Model 5390 parameter defines the number of seconds between the transmission of identification
packets during times of network inactivity. This parameter works only for the LAT protocol. The
packets serve only as notices to remote nodes that the host's services are available. Allowable values
range from 10 to 255 (seconds). The default is 20 (seconds).
